Prague Zoo: An oasis of nature in the heart of the city
Prague Zoo is one of the most important zoos in the Czech Republic and an important centre for biodiversity conservation. The zoo is located in the picturesque location of Troja and offers visitors a unique experience of encountering the fascinating world of animals.
Mission and nature conservation
Prague Zoo is actively involved in the conservation of endangered species and ecosystems. Its activities include:
– Ex-situ research and conservation (outside the natural environment).
– Participation in in-situ projects (in the natural environment)
– Educating the public about the importance of biodiversity conservation
